AppPkg/Python-2.7.10: Rename identifiers beginning with "posix_" to "edk2_".

Rename identifiers to have an edk2_ prefix instead of posix_ in order to
conform to the convention used in other environment-specific Python modules.
This also makes the names match the module instead of implying that these are
Posix compatible routines.
